Market Overview

The Transcatheter Valve Delivery Devices market is witnessing robust growth, driven by advancements in minimally invasive cardiac procedures, increasing prevalence of valvular heart diseases, and growing adoption of transcatheter heart valve therapies. Transcatheter valve delivery devices play a critical role in delivering and deploying transcatheter heart valves through minimally invasive procedures, offering patients a less invasive alternative to traditional open-heart surgery. This market’s expansion is propelled by technological innovations, expanding indications for transcatheter valve therapies, and rising demand for improved patient outcomes and quality of life.

Meaning

Transcatheter Valve Delivery Devices are specialized medical devices used in transcatheter heart valve procedures to deliver and deploy heart valves within the cardiovascular system via minimally invasive techniques. These devices facilitate precise positioning and deployment of transcatheter heart valves, enabling cardiologists and cardiac surgeons to treat valvular heart diseases such as aortic stenosis and mitral regurgitation without the need for open-heart surgery. Transcatheter valve delivery devices are essential components of transcatheter heart valve systems, contributing to improved procedural success rates and patient outcomes.

Category-wise Insights

  • Device Design and Ergonomics: Innovations in device design, including smaller delivery profiles, improved navigational capabilities, and user-friendly interfaces, enhance procedural efficiency and operator experience.
  • Imaging Integration: Integration of advanced imaging modalities, such as 3D echocardiography, computed tomography (CT), and fluoroscopy, improves procedural planning, device positioning, and patient outcomes.
  • Procedural Safety: Implementation of safety features, such as embolic protection devices, rapid pacing systems, and hemodynamic monitoring, mitigates procedural risks and enhances patient safety during transcatheter heart valve procedures.

Transcatheter Valve Delivery Devices Market

Segmentation:

Segmentation Details Details
Type Transfemoral Approach, Transapical Approach, Transaortic Approach, Trans-subclavian Approach
Valve Type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ement (TAVR), Transcatheter Mitral Valve Replacement (TMVR), Others
End User Hospitals, Ambulatory Surgical Centers, Cardiac Catheterization Laboratories
Region North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, Middle East & Africa
